`
shenzhw
  • 浏览: 61742 次
  • 性别: Icon_minigender_1
  • 来自: 福州
文章分类
社区版块
存档分类
最新评论
文章列表
今天终于想出了个电子把这个问题解决了。记录一下: package com.sysnet.test; import java.lang.reflect.Field; import java.lang.reflect.InvocationTargetException; import java.lang.reflect.Method; import java.util.HashMap; import java.util.Iterator; import java.util.Map; public class Test { public static void main( ...
这里我介绍一种很常用,也比较Professor的权限控制思路。 这里我用java语言描述,其实都差不多的。自己转一下就可以了。 为了方便,我们这里定义a^b为:a的b次方 这里,我们为每一个操作设定一个唯一的整数值,比如: 删除A---0 修改A---1 添加A---2 删除B---3 修改B---4 添加B---5 。。。 理论上可以有N个操作,这取决于你用于储存用户权限值的数据类型了。 这样,如果用户有权限:添加A---2;删除B---3;修改B---4 那用户的权限值 purview =2^2+2^3+2^4=28,也就是2的权的和了(之前打错了)。 化 ...
原来JS 和 applet是可以相互通信的。难怪汇智互联。
http://www.iteye.com/topic/806990
cookie概述【转】 并修改  假如利用一个不变的框架来存储购物栏数据,而商品显示页面是不断变化的,尽管这样能达到一个模拟全局变量的功能,但并不严谨。例如在导航框架页面内右击,单击快捷菜单中的【刷新】命令,则 ...
今天对前边做的进度条进行了改进,MyJQuery.js文件可到附件中下载。 <html> <head> <script type="text/javascript" src="../jquery-1.4.2.min.js"></script> <script type="text/javascript" src="MyJQuery.js"></script> <script type="text/java ...
因项目需要,用JQuery作了个进度条,原理很简单。 <html> <head> <link rel="stylesheet" type="text/css" href="../themes/default/easyui.css"> <link rel="stylesheet" type="text/css" href="../themes/icon.css"> <style type=" ...
今天听人说到scrum,sprint等名词,不明白。 “ **,       格式和人员均到位,请安排推进,将***纳入本Sprint管理。   ***,       希望你能适应我们的SCRUM敏捷管理模式。 ” 在网上找了一下,大概如下: 一 什么是S ...
今日闲来无事,自己用CSS+DIV做了个面板。图片在附件中。 效果如下:   因为时间原因,面板上几个工具对应的响应函数还没写上。     <html> <head> <style> .panel{ overflow:hidden; font-size:12px; width:300px; margin:20px; } .panel-header{ padding:5px; line-height:15px; color:#15428b; ...
端口文件为jboss-5.0.0.GA\server\default\conf\bootstrap\bindings.xml
在jboss的数据源文件oracle-ds.xml中,当<use-java-context>true</use-java-context>时,jndi名称为"java:odsjndi";当<use-java-context>false</use-java-context>时,jndi名称为"odsjndi"。
http://jializheng.iteye.com/blog/421017
通过开源软件dnsjava来获取 try{ Lookup lookup=new Lookup("foxmail.com",Type.MX); lookup.setResolver(new SimpleResolver("172.19.5.35")); lookup.run(); System.out.println(lookup.getErrorString()); if(lookup.getResult()!=Lookup.SUCCESSFUL){ System.out.println("E ...
Ctrl+1 快速修复(最经典的快捷键,就不用多说了) Ctrl+D: 删除当前行 Ctrl+Alt+↓ 复制当前行到下一行(复制增加) Ctrl+Alt+↑ 复制当前行到上一行(复制增加) Alt+↓ 当前行和下面一行交互位置(特别实用,可以省去先剪切,再粘贴了) Alt+↑ ...
jdbc连接各数据库及事务处理: 下面罗列了各种数据库使用JDBC连接的方式: 1、Oracle8/8i/9i数据库(thin模式) Class.forName("oracle.jdbc.driver.OracleDriver").newInstance(); String url="jdbc:oracle:thin:@localhost:1521:orcl"; //orcl为数据库的SID String user="test"; String password="test"; Connection conn= ...
Global site tag (gtag.js) - Google Analytics